The Summary
- Nava raised $8.3M in seed funding to build escrow infrastructure for AI agents handling financial transactions
- The core problem: autonomous agents need guardrails when they're authorized to spend real money on your behalf
- Their solution combines blockchain-based escrow with controls that let humans set boundaries before agents start transacting

Nava is building escrow rails for the agentic economy, and the timing tells you everything about where we are in the Web4 transition. When a startup can raise $8.3 million to solve a problem that didn't exist 18 months ago, that's not hype. That's infrastructure racing to catch up with capability.
Here's the setup. AI agents are getting good enough to handle complex multi-step tasks autonomously. Book the flight. Order the parts. Pay the contractor. The models can do the reasoning. APIs exist for the actions. But there's a gap between "the agent can technically do this" and "I trust the agent with my credit card."
"The problem isn't whether agents can transact. It's what happens when they do it wrong."
Nava's approach uses blockchain-based escrow as a control layer. You set parameters upfront: spending limits, vendor whitelists, approval thresholds. The agent operates within those boundaries. When it wants to transact, funds move into escrow first. If something goes sideways, you have a window to intervene before settlement. It's guardrails for autonomous commerce.
The bigger pattern here is about trust infrastructure for agent economies. We've spent a decade building tools that assume a human is clicking the button. Now we need systems that assume the human isn't even watching. That's a different design problem.
Three reasons this matters now:
- Agent capabilities are outpacing safety infrastructure by 6-12 months
- Financial services companies are testing agent-based workflows but won't deploy without liability controls
- The companies building agent platforms need this layer to exist before enterprise adoption scales
The blockchain piece isn't incidental. Escrow needs transparency, programmable rules, and settlement finality. Traditional payment rails weren't built for machine-to-machine transactions with human oversight. Crypto rails were.
